Why Is iCloud Lock Important?

The iCloud lock feature, also known as Activation Lock, is designed to prevent unauthorized use of a lost or stolen iPhone. When enabled, it requires the original Apple ID and password to activate or reset the device. If a phone is iCloud locked, it cannot be reset or used by the new owner until the lock is removed.

How to Check iCloud Lock Status Before Trading

Before completing a trade or sale, verify the iCloud lock status using these methods:

  • Ask the Seller: Request the seller to disable the iCloud lock or provide proof that the device is unlocked.
  • Use Apple’s Activation Lock Status Website: Visit https://www.icloud.com/activationlock/ and enter the device’s IMEI or serial number.
  • Check in Settings: If possible, turn on the device and navigate to Settings > Apple ID. If the device prompts for an Apple ID password, it is locked.
